When homeowners search for signs their air ducts need cleaning, they are usually looking for indicators that their HVAC system may be affected by dust, debris, or mold buildup within the ductwork. Common concerns include persistent dust around vents, unexplained allergies or respiratory issues, and a noticeable musty odor emanating from the vents. Many people also notice that their heating or cooling system isn't performing as efficiently as it used to, which could be a sign that airflow is obstructed by accumulated dirt or obstructions inside the ducts. Recognizing these signs early can help prevent more significant problems, such as increased energy bills or potential health issues, making it important to understand what to watch for.
This topic often relates to broader plans of maintaining a healthy indoor environment and optimizing HVAC system performance. Dirty air ducts can circulate allergens, dust, pet dander, and mold spores throughout a home, impacting air quality and potentially aggravating allergies or asthma. Additionally, clogged ducts can cause your heating or cooling system to work harder, leading to higher energy consumption and wear on equipment. The types of properties that typically come up when discussing signs your air ducts need cleaning include residential homes, especially those with multiple occupants, pets, or recent renovations that generate dust and debris. Older houses with extensive ductwork or previous issues with mold or pests may also be more prone to duct contamination. Additionally, multi-family buildings, condominiums, and apartment complexes often encounter duct-related concerns due to shared ventilation systems. Commercial properties such as offices, retail spaces, and small industrial settings might also experience similar issues, particularly if HVAC systems haven't been maintained regularly.
